Output 55964e24a1ab3205794f93794b35e060217f95749871c74b0f5c9bde89d83c93:0

value
51186062
script pubkey
OP_HASH160 OP_PUSHBYTES_20 083607cacfa8158d382c5a3c4713d93b968ce743 OP_EQUAL
address
M8eaN4kcYdPwXaag8sZDXYUKTe8VvAXSWv
transaction
55964e24a1ab3205794f93794b35e060217f95749871c74b0f5c9bde89d83c93
spent
true